Context: The Banking Disintermediation Mirage
BlackRock's strategy is the latest symptom of a decades-long shift from bank-intermediated lending to capital-market intermediation. Post-2008 regulations forced banks to hold more capital, pushing risky loans to shadow banking. Private credit firms like Apollo and Blackstone stepped in, offering yield to institutional investors at the cost of liquidity and transparency. Now BlackRock, the world's largest asset manager with $10 trillion under management, wants a slice. Its $220 billion “war chest” is partly from client rebalancing and partly from leverage. The goal: undercut incumbents on pricing and scale.
But here is the irony. DeFi has spent the past five years building a permissionless alternative that achieves the same disintermediation with radically different properties. On Aave, a borrower can get a loan by overcollateralizing with liquid assets. The smart contract enforces liquidation when the health factor drops below 1, all in public. No phone calls, no negotiations, no delays. Governance is a myth; the bypass reveals the truth. In DeFi, the code is the only authority. In traditional private credit, the authority is a human relationship.

Contrarian: The Hidden Advantage of Opacity
Here is the counter-intuitive angle: opacity is not always a bug. In DeFi, every liquidatable position is visible to bots, leading to front-running and MEV extraction. Traditional private credit avoids this because information is private. BlackRock's entry might actually make the system more stable, not less, because it centralizes information inside a single balance sheet. But that centralization is exactly what DeFi was built to avoid. As I wrote after the Terra-Luna crash, tracing the binary decay of a system requires public logs. Without them, the next crash will surprise everyone.
